Earth Week at Fern

The ECO Team has planned some events for Earth Week, April 18th to April 21st.

Please join us in keeping Fern green and encouraging everyone to help out.

Tuesday, Apr. 18th – Boomerang Lunch/Litterless Lunch Day.

All students should be bringing a Boomerang lunch to school if they stay for lunch. Please bring a litterless or boomerang lunch to school today. A boomerang lunch means you take all garbage and compost home with you. A litterless lunch means exactly that, no litter! We also encourage litterless snacks or a reduction of snacks with a lot of packaging. Teachers, please be a role model and do the same! Eco Team members will be in the lunchroom and awarding prizes to students they see participating.

Wednesday, Apr. 19th-ECO Art

The Eco team will cut eco paper into squares and distribute them to classes (one per student). Given how well the student council activity went, with older grades paired with younger grades, we figured we would try this again.
Work with another class, or on your own (we leave this up to you), to decorate each square of paper with an Eco message. You can mount them on a piece of construction paper and hang them in your classrooms. If there are any classes who may need assistance to mount their pieces of art, please let us know, we will be happy to help.

Thursday, Apr. 20th–Bike/Walk/Scooter to School Day.
Please use public transit OR bike, walk or scooter to school today. If you can get to and from school without a car today, then that would be fantastic! If you must drive, please consider carpooling for today. The Eco Team will on the lookout for students and teachers who do any of the above, you may win a prize for your efforts.

Friday, Apr. 21st – EARTH DAY! Dress Your Eco Best!
Dress up as a tree, bird, squirrel, flower or whatever to show that you care about the environment! Or show your spirit by wearing earthy colours/tones, such as green, brown, beige or yellow!

Cleaning the Schoolyard and Sorauren Park.
All classes are encouraged to sign up for a time to clean up our school’s area in the front, the primary and junior/senior yards, or Sorauren Park. Let’s keep our school grounds clean and beautiful! The sign-up sheet will be placed on Vera’s desk for teachers to sign up their classes. The Eco Team will provide gloves and plastic bags.
